频道栏目
首页 > 程序开发 > 软件开发 > C语言 > 正文
switch default
2011-08-16 15:51:50           
收藏   我要投稿

#include <stdio.h>  
int main(int argc, char *argv[]) 

    int x=8;//x=1  
    switch(x) 
    { 
        default:  
        { 
            printf("de "); 
        } 
        case 1:  
        { 
            printf("1 "); 
        } 
         
        case 2:  
        { 
            printf("2 "); 
        } 
        case 3:  
        { 
            printf("3 "); 
        } 
         
    } 
    return 0; 

#include <stdio.h>
int main(int argc, char *argv[])
{
 int x=8;//x=1
 switch(x)
 {
  default:
  {
   printf("de ");
  }
  case 1:
  {
   printf("1 ");
  }
  
  case 2:
  {
   printf("2 ");
  }
  case 3:
  {
   printf("3 ");
  }
  
 }
 return 0;
}
 
x=8时输出: de 1 2 3
x=1时输出: 1 2 3
default关键字可理解为“others”

 switch不以default为结束,而已代码的最下面为结束

点击复制链接 与好友分享!回本站首页
相关TAG标签 switch default
上一篇:做MTK笔试的总结(一)
下一篇:HDU 1217 Arbitrage
相关文章
图文推荐
点击排行

关于我们 | 联系我们 | 广告服务 | 投资合作 | 版权申明 | 在线帮助 | 网站地图 | 作品发布 | Vip技术培训 | 举报中心

版权所有: 红黑联盟--致力于做实用的IT技术学习网站